A force of 62 N acting on a 35 kg object applies an acceleration a of

62 N = (35 kg) a

a = (62 N) / (35 kg) ≈ 1.8 m/s²

If v₀ is the object's initial velocity, then after 10.0 s it attains a final velocity v of

v = v₀ + a t

v = v₀ + (1.8 m/s²) (10.0 s)

v = v₀ + 18 m/s

so that the change in velocity is

∆v = v - v₀ = 18 m/s
